Electro @ Soul Cellar, Southampton
Upstairs - Trance & Techno Jon Gurd (Slinky) Weatherman (Fire107.6FM) Techno Engineer (Corvotech) Owen Clark Claire White Downstairs - Beats & Breaks Wub (Trancendance) Chegs C.H.A.P. (Alan Parfett B2B DJ Solrac) Electro is @ Soul Cellar, Southampton (opposite the Guildhall) 8pm-2am £3 B4 10:30pm, £4 after

Is Microclubbing the way forward?
Micro clubbing is basically a reversion back to the old DIY ethos, and house parties. [censored] music policy, dress codes, you can't stand there, you can't sit there, you can't have fun. [censored] it all. Clubbing has been, and always will be about having a good time with your friends. And not having to wear a smart shirt and pay £15 to do so.
